Honda has offered engines and know-how to IndyCar for many years, being one of many solely two producers to take action. And regardless of the racing wing of Honda seemingly having nothing to do with the Passports and Civics we see on the street, plenty of what makes these IndyCars carry out so effectively does truly trickle down into Honda’s passenger vehicles.
Earlier than the race, we sat down with Honda Racing Company (HRC) president David Salters and vp Kelvin Fu to debate the method.
2026 Indy 500
The very first thing to learn about how completely different applied sciences are distributed throughout Honda’s manufacturers is the Honda Technical Discussion board. Annually, the completely different branches of Honda—sure, even HondaJet—all meet as much as talk about what they’ve been as much as, and the potential functions for various items of tech. David Salters explains:
‘So final yr, it was hybrid, and folks had been choosing up on issues that we have discovered right here by way of vitality administration, by way of the right way to use the hybrid, et cetera.’
The give attention to hybridization for the Honda manufacturers is essential. Regardless of the $9 billion misstep within the model’s EV funding, Honda has been an early and quick adopter of hybrid applied sciences, one thing that exhibits up within the engines they provide to IndyCar.

For instance, Honda’s IndyCars use supercapacitors, a know-how that, whereas frequent on fashionable race vehicles, has but to hit the patron facet the identical approach. In line with HRC US Vice President Kelvin Fu, speaking about these applied sciences to completely different wings of Honda, in addition to shoppers, is an effective way to gauge curiosity from all events.
‘It makes individuals assume. I believe individuals are at all times going, ‘Oh, supercompacitors. That was attention-grabbing.’ They need to study extra about it, whether or not it exhibits up subsequent yr, 2 years, 5 years.’

The most important similarity between Honda’s racing vehicles and what we see on the street is the software program. “Bear in mind, a racing automotive is a software-defined automobile,” says Salters. He talks about how Honda can go in and alter and create its personal code to change sure elements of the hybrid system, one thing that’s key in high-performance functions just like the Indianapolis 500.
‘However how we cope with vitality, simulation, all that kind of stuff. It is all been run on a software-defined automobile. There have been software-defined autos for 30 years. So, that is the place a few of the studying comes from.’
Lastly, Honda Racing makes use of instruments like simulators and wind tunnels to check out completely different applied sciences, together with the aforementioned hybrid system, for the very best outcomes. Fu says there is no such thing as a direct path to a chunk of code within the engine of an IndyCar ending up in a Civic, however Honda’s completely different segments working collectively and sharing know-how allows sooner adaptability.
‘I am positive there have been applied sciences and information has handed forwards and backwards. Hopefully, it is simply inviting itself on the manufacturing facet.’
